According to Blended: Using Disruptive Innovation to Improve Schools, by Michael Horn and Heather Staker, blended learning is a formal education program, 1) delivered at least in part through digital learning, with some flexibility for students to choose the way they want to learn, 2) at least partly in combination with a physical classroom and teacher, and 3) with opportunities for students to learn through activities that capitalize on different learning modalities.  The benefits include flexibility, effectiveness, efficiency, cost-effectiveness, personalization, extended reach, and covers all learning styles. 

While there are many ways to apply blended learning to a curriculum, some of the most popular examples include flipped classroom models, where students learn online at home, then spend in-class time practicing with a teacher available to assist them; or rotation models, where students move between learning stations, with at least one station being a digital space where students can access a variety of learning resources. 

The most noteworthy disadvantage with blended learning is that it relies heavily on technology to deliver online learning experiences.  The digital tools and online assets need to be reliable, easy to use and up-to-date for them to have meaningful impact.  Technical issues encountered by employees can be a significant barrier.  It is important to put measures in place for high availability and strong technical support.
